Ingredients for Creamsicle Perfection ๐Ÿ›’

For the Jello Layer:

  • 1 (3 ounce) box orange jello ๐Ÿงก
  • 1 cup boiling water ๐Ÿ’ฆ

For the Graham Cracker Crust:

  • 2 cups Graham Cracker crumbs (about 14 sheets) ๐Ÿช
  • 6 tablespoon unsalted butter, melted ๐Ÿงˆ
  • Pinch salt ๐Ÿง‚

For the Cheesecake Filling:

  • 2 (8 ounce) blocks cream cheese, softened ๐Ÿง€
  • 1 1โ„2 cups powdered sugar, divided ๐Ÿฌ
  • 2 cups heavy whipping cream ๐Ÿฅ›
  • 1โ„2 teaspoon vanilla extract ๐Ÿงด
  • Zest of 1 orange, optional (but highly recommended!) ๐ŸŠ

For Serving (Optional):

  • Extra whipped cream for decorating ๐Ÿ’ฏ
  • Fresh orange slices for garnish ๐ŸŠ
  • Orange zest for sprinkling โœจ
  • Mint leaves for a pop of color ๐ŸŒฟ
  • Crushed graham crackers for texture ๐Ÿช

Step-by-Step Instructions

  • Make the orange jello: Add the orange jello powder and boiling water to a heat-proof bowl. Whisk until well combined, then set aside to cool fully, about 30 minutes. ๐Ÿ”ฅ
  • Make the crust: In a medium bowl, mix the Graham Cracker crumbs, melted butter, and salt until well combined. Press the mixture evenly into the bottom and slightly up the sides of the pan. Place in the freezer for at least 30 minutes. โ„๏ธ
  • Make the cheesecake filling: In a large bowl, beat the softened cream cheese and 1 cup powdered sugar with an electric mixer until smooth and creamy, about 2 minutes. Set aside. ๐Ÿง€
  • Whip the cream: In a separate bowl, whip the heavy cream, 1/2 cup powdered sugar, vanilla extract, and orange zest until stiff peaks form. The cream should stand up when you lift the beaters! ๐Ÿ’ช
  • Combine the mixtures: Gently fold half of the whipped cream into the cream cheese mixture until combined. This creates your vanilla layer! ๐Ÿค
  • Create the orange layer: Fold the remaining whipped cream into the cooled jello mixture. This gives you that beautiful orange creamsicle flavor! ๐Ÿงก
  • Assemble: Alternate spooning the cream cheese and jello mixtures into the prepared crust, creating layers. Use a butter knife to gently swirl the two together for that perfect marble effect! ๐ŸŒ€
  • Chill to perfection: Cover and refrigerate the cheesecake for at least 6 hours or overnight until completely set. Patience is key here โ€“ I know itโ€™s hard to wait! โฐ
  • Serve with style: When ready to serve, remove the sides of the springform pan. If desired, pipe dollops of whipped cream around the edges and garnish with orange slices. Slice and enjoy! ๐ŸŽจ

Pro Tips for Cheesecake Success ๐Ÿ†

After making this no-bake dessert countless times, Iโ€™ve picked up some tricks that make a huge difference:

  • Temperature matters! Make sure your cream cheese is truly room temperature โ€“ leave it out for at least 2 hours. Cold cream cheese = lumpy cheesecake! ๐ŸŒก๏ธ
  • Donโ€™t rush the cooling of the jello โ€“ if itโ€™s too warm when you add it to the whipped cream, it will collapse. โฑ๏ธ
  • Use full-fat cream cheese for the richest, creamiest texture. Diet desserts have their place, but this isnโ€™t it! ๐Ÿ˜…
  • Chill the mixing bowl and beaters before whipping the cream for best results. ๐ŸงŠ
  • For the perfect swirl, donโ€™t overmix when combining the orange and white batters โ€“ just a few gentle strokes with a knife or skewer creates beautiful patterns! ๐ŸŽจ
  • Use fresh orange zest rather than dried for the brightest flavor. The oils in fresh zest make a huge difference! ๐ŸŠ
  • For a cleaner cut, dip your knife in hot water and wipe clean between slices. ๐Ÿ”ช
  • If your crust seems too dry when mixing, add an extra tablespoon of melted butter. If itโ€™s too wet, add more graham cracker crumbs. ๐Ÿ‘Œ

Frequently Asked Questions ๐Ÿค”

Can I make this with sugar-free jello and sweeteners?

Yes! You can use sugar-free jello and substitute the powdered sugar with a powdered sweetener like Swerve or erythritol. The texture may be slightly different, but it will still be delicious! ๐Ÿ‘Œ

My cheesecake isnโ€™t setting properly. What went wrong?

The most common culprit is not whipping the cream to stiff enough peaks or not chilling long enough. Make sure your cream is properly whipped and give it at least 6 hours in the refrigerator โ€“ overnight is even better! โฐ

Can I use a regular cake pan instead of a springform?

You can, but removing and serving will be trickier. If using a regular pan, line it completely with parchment paper with overhang on the sides to help lift it out. ๐Ÿ“

Is there a way to make this without graham crackers?

Absolutely! Any cookie crumb will work โ€“ vanilla wafers, digestive biscuits, or even chocolate cookies for a chocolate-orange twist. Just make sure theyโ€™re crushed finely and mixed well with butter. ๐Ÿช

How far in advance can I make this?

This cheesecake can be made up to 2 days ahead and kept refrigerated. You can also freeze it for up to 3 months! ๐Ÿ“…

My jello started to set before I could mix it with the whipped cream. What now?

If your jello begins to set, gently rewarm it for just a few seconds in the microwave until it becomes liquid again, then let it cool (but not set) before proceeding. ๐Ÿ”„

Soft, rich, and oh-so-fruity, this no-bake orange creamsicle cheesecake is an irresistible summer dessert that tastes just like the classic frozen treat.

Ingredients

  • 1 (3 ounce) box orange jello

  • 1 cup boiling water

  • 2 cups Graham Cracker crumbs (about 14 sheets)

  • 6 tablespoon unsalted butter, melted

  • pinch salt

  • 2 (8 ounce) blocks cream cheese, softened

  • 1 1โ„2 cups powdered sugar, divided

  • 2 cups heavy whipping cream

  • 1โ„2 teaspoon vanilla extract

  • zest of 1 orange, optional

Directions

  • Make the orange jello: Add the orange jello powder and boiling water to a heat-proof bowl Whisk until well combined, then set aside to cool fully, about 30 minutes.
  • Spray a 9-inch springform pan with cooking spray and line the bottom and sides with parchment.
  • Make the crust: In a medium bowl, mix the Graham Cracker crumbs, melted butter, and salt until well combined. Press the mixture evenly into the bottom and slightly up the sides of the pan. Place in the freezer for at least 30 minutes.
  • Make the cheesecake filling: In a large bowl, beat the softened cream cheese and 1 cup powdered sugar with an electric mixer until smooth and creamy, about 2 minutes. Set aside.
  • In a separate bowl, whip the heavy cream, 1/2 cup powdered sugar, vanilla extract, and orange zest until stiff peaks form. Gently fold half of the whipped cream into the cream cheese mixture until combined.
  • Fold the remaining whipped cream into the cooled jello mixture.
  • Assemble: Alternate spooning the cream cheese and jello mixtures into the prepared crust, creating layers. Use a butter knife to gently swirl the two together.
  • Cover and refrigerate the cheesecake for at least 6 hours or overnight until completely set.
  • When ready to serve, remove the sides of the springform pan. If desired, pipe dollops of whipped cream around the edges and garnish with orange slices. Slice and enjoy!

Notes

  • Room temperature.ย Ensure the cream cheese is at room temperature before mixing to avoid lumps in the filling.
    Dissolve completely.ย Whisk the orange jello and boiling water until fully dissolved, then let it cool to room temp before adding the whipped cream.
    Whip it cold.ย Whip the cold heavy cream in a cold bowl for the most stable peaks.
